How to properly manage a WhatsApp group to attract customers - in detail?

Managing a WhatsApp group effectively is crucial for attracting and retaining customers in today's digitally connected world. Here are some detailed strategies to help you achieve this:

  1. Define Clear Objectives: Before creating the group, determine its purpose and goals. Whether it's to provide customer support, share updates, or promote products, having clear objectives will guide your management approach.
  2. Invite Relevant Members: Ensure that the members you invite are genuinely interested in your business or industry. Sending invitations to random contacts can lead to low engagement and high dropout rates.
  3. Set Group Rules: Establishing rules for the group helps maintain order and professionalism. These could include no spamming, respectful language, and relevant discussions only. Communicate these rules clearly when members join.
  4. Appoint a Moderator: If your group grows large, consider appointing a moderator to help manage posts, remove inappropriate content, and ensure all discussions are on-topic. This ensures the group remains a valuable resource for customers.
  5. Regularly Update Content: Keep the group active by regularly posting updates, promotions, and useful information related to your business. This could include new product launches, industry news, or helpful tips related to your niche.
  6. Engage with Members: Respond promptly to messages and queries from members. Showing genuine interest in their concerns builds trust and loyalty. Use polls, questions, and interactive content to encourage engagement and feedback.
  7. Offer Exclusive Benefits: Provide group members with exclusive deals, early access to promotions, or special discounts. This incentivizes participation and makes customers feel valued for being part of the group.
  8. Monitor Analytics: Use WhatsApp Business to track metrics such as message delivery rates, open rates, and response times. Analyzing this data helps you understand what works best and where improvements are needed.
  9. Promote the Group Externally: Leverage your website, social media platforms, email newsletters, and other marketing channels to promote your WhatsApp group. The more members you have, the greater your reach and potential customer base.
  10. Maintain Privacy and Security: Ensure that personal data shared within the group is protected. Use end-to-end encryption features provided by WhatsApp and remind members not to share sensitive information publicly.

By implementing these strategies, you can effectively manage your WhatsApp group and create a valuable platform for attracting and engaging customers.
